Mets’ New General Manager Accused of Harassing Female Reporter

Mets General Manager Jared Porter sent over 60 unsolicited text messages, including one of a naked penis, to a female baseball reporter in 2016, ESPN reported Monday night.

The Mets, in a statement by Sandy Alderson, the team’s president, announced they would review the matter. The Chicago Cubs, who were Porter’s employers at the time of the incident, said they will investigate the issue as well.

Porter and the woman met just once, when he was the director of professional scouting for the Cubs, and the two exchanged business cards. The woman, who was not named in the report, told ESPN that she believed she was beginning a standard reporter-source relationship with Porter, but that Porter’s tone quickly became unprofessional.
